ALTERNATIVE STRATEGY FOR CONVERSION OF WASTE PLASTIC INTO PETROLEUM FUEL

Abstract
This project is about the recycling of plastic and converting it into the useful industrial fuels.so the dumping problem of the plastic is reduced and the pollution due to dumping of plastic can be reduced and also the use of petroleum fuels are replaced by this fuel and the other natural fuels are conserved.it is the simple process of doing catalytic cracking of plastic in absence of oxygen by pyrolysis process and doing distillation process to convert the plastic into crude oil carbon char and other useful gases. Plastic is an indispensable part of our daily life. Its production and consumption has been rising very rapidly due to its wide range of application. Due to its non-biodegradable nature it cannot be easily disposed of. So, nowadays new technology is being used to treat the waste plastic one of such process is pyrolysis. Under the pyrolytic and cracking conditions the plastic wastes can be decomposed into three fractions: gas. Liquid and solid residue. The waste plastics consisting of high density polyethylene (HDPE) was pyrolyzed in this study. The pyrolysis of plastic wastes produces a whole spectrum of hydrocarbons including paraffin’s. Olefins, naphthalene’s and aromatics. The liquid product yield is about 76% in all the cases. In thermal pyrolysis, the product obtained gets solidified but in catalytic cracking good liquid product can be obtained which can be used as fuel. This application is further combined with technologies of municipal plastic wastes collection, classification and pre-treatment at front end and product purification and testing at back end to determine the properties of the various products obtained.
